Pulvinar projections to the striatum and amygdala in the tree shrew
Visually guided movement is possible in the absence of conscious visual perception, a phenomenon referred to as "blindsight" Similarly, fearful images can elicit emotional responses in the absence of their conscious perception. Both capabilities are thought to be mediated by pathways from...
